​ Explore Liberal Arts Educational Options March 15 at COD Virtual Spotlight

Discover educational opportunities in a diverse range of areas during the virtual Liberal Arts Division Spotlight from 5 to 7 p.m. Monday, March 15.

This event is free and open to the public.

During the event, prospective new students can explore academic paths and transfer possibilities through COD’s 2+2 program in partnership with four-year institutions, learn about stackable credentials and certificates in American Sign Language Interpreting, Professional Writing and Creative Writing, and learn how to participate in various clubs and study abroad opportunities.

The Liberal Arts Division at COD encompasses a broad range of program offerings including English, English Language studies, History, Humanities, Interpreting, Languages including American Sign Language, Philosophy and Religious Studies.

College of DuPage is regionally accredited by the Higher Learning Commission. Serving approximately 21,000 students each term, College of DuPage is the largest public community college in the state of Illinois. The College grants seven associate degrees and offers more than 170 career and technical certificates in over 50 areas of study.
